Transaction 8e627ea7624fcd941cab1e05bae9fa135a28dd67daee4d1f5aa590b6f273c67a
1 Input
1 Output
-
8e627ea7624fcd941cab1e05bae9fa135a28dd67daee4d1f5aa590b6f273c67a:0
- value
- 86522
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9bfaec1644def709047c4e5faa9b4588e854b1a2 OP_EQUAL
- address
- 3FumFf9n5sEdQ2hmFpRszqXMKRW4C4FiEJ